Canadian cuisine is wonderfully diverse, shaped by its melting pot of cultures and traditions. Among these, Indian food stands out, offering a rich variety of flavors, spices, and textures that appeal to both expats longing for a taste of home and adventurous food enthusiasts keen to experiment with something new. From fragrant curries to baked naan, Indian cuisine has firmly established its presence across Canada.
This guide will take you through the best ways to enjoy Indian food in Canada, whether you’re dining out, cooking at home, or searching for wallet-friendly options. We’ll also explore the health benefits of Indian dishes, where to find the best deals and coupons, and even provide some answers to your top questions about Indian cuisine in the FAQs section.
Let’s discover how Indian food has carved out a space in Canadian kitchens and restaurants while maintaining its authenticity.
Table of Contents
Indian Food Culture in Canada
Indian food has become a beloved part of Canada’s culinary scene, enjoyed by both immigrants and locals. From street-style snacks to fine dining, its rich flavors are widely available across restaurants and grocery stores. With easy access to Indian ingredients, more Canadians are embracing home-cooked curries and spice-infused dishes. Indian cuisine in Canada isn’t just about food—it’s a cultural connection that continues to grow.
The Rise of Indian Cuisine in Canada
Indian food started gaining popularity in Canada with the arrival of Indian immigrants, particularly in urban centers such as Toronto, Vancouver, and Montreal. Over the years, it has transformed from a niche choice to a mainstream culinary option, available in both fine dining establishments and casual takeout spots.
According to a report by Statistics Canada, Indian immigrants make up about 25% of Canada’s contemporary immigrant population, meaning Indian cuisine is not only widely available but well-refined to suit a diverse audience without losing authenticity. This makes Indian food one of the most accessible global cuisines in Canada today.
Indian Restaurants in Canada
Canada offers a plethora of Indian food options, from high-end restaurants specializing in regional Indian cuisine to small local eateries serving budget-friendly classics. Some well-loved spots include restaurants like Vij’s in Vancouver and Pukka in Toronto. These establishments specialize in everything from rich butter chicken to fresh samosas.
Pro Tip – If you’re new to Indian food, start with staples like biryani, tandoori chicken, dal makhani (lentils), and butter naan to get a taste of traditional flavors.
Quick Data Insight
City | Popular Indian Dishes | Average Cost per Meal (CAD) | Recommended Eateries |
---|---|---|---|
Toronto | Butter Chicken, Naan | $15 – $25 | Pukka, The Copper Chimney |
Vancouver | Biryani, Masala Chai | $12 – $30 | Vij’s, Salaam Bombay |
Montreal | Tikka Masala, Samosas | $13 – $23 | Le Taj, Devi |
Calgary | Paneer Tikka, Aloo Gobi | $10 – $20 | Mango Shiva, Zaika |
Grocery Stores for Indian Ingredients
Most metropolitan areas host specialty Indian grocery stores, such as Patel Brothers or South Asian Groceries. These stores stock pantry essentials like basmati rice, lentils, paneer, and a wide selection of pre-made spice blends to bring authenticity to your homemade cooking. Larger chains like Walmart and Superstore also now carry Indian ingredients due to their increasing popularity among local Canadians.
Cooking Indian Food at Home
Cooking Indian food at home is a cost-effective and fun way to enjoy the cuisine. With the right ingredients and recipes, you can prepare a variety of Indian dishes that cater to your preferred spice levels. For frugal shoppers and home cooks, this option is both practical and rewarding.
Here’s an easy dish to get you started at home:
Recipe Idea – Quick Dal Tadka
- Ingredients
- 1 cup lentils
- 3 cups water
- 1 tsp turmeric
- 2 tsp ghee (clarified butter)
- 1 tsp cumin seeds
- 2 chopped garlic cloves
- 1 chopped tomato
- Salt to taste
- Instructions
- Rinse lentils and boil with water and turmeric until soft.
- Heat ghee, add cumin seeds till they crackle, then sauté garlic and tomatoes.
- Mix the boiled lentils with the sautéed garlic and tomatoes.
- Serve this protein-rich dish with rice or flatbread.
Discounts and Deals on Indian Food
Who doesn’t love a good deal, especially on delicious food?
Platforms like UberEats and SkipTheDishes often provide discounts on popular Indian restaurants across Canada. Additionally, websites like Groupon frequently have vouchers for Indian buffets and set menus. Some stores that import Indian spices and staples, such as T&T Supermarket and No Frills, also offer weekly deals.
Pro Tip – Many restaurants host special Thali lunches (a platter of different dishes) at discounted prices to give diners a more comprehensive tasting experience.

The Health Benefits of Indian Cuisine
Indian food is not just about bold flavors; it’s also incredibly nutritious. From cumin’s anti-inflammatory properties to the gut-friendly effects of turmeric, many ingredients in Indian cuisine offer substantial health benefits.
Some Notable Benefits Include:
- Nutrient-Rich Lentils and Pulses: High in protein and good for heart health.
- Anti-Inflammatory Turmeric: Widely used in curries and teas.
- Digestive Benefits of Spices: Ingredients like cumin, fennel, and ginger aid digestion.
- Vegetarian Options: From spinach-based saag paneer to chickpea curries like chana masala, Indian food is an excellent option for vegetarians and vegans.
Frequently Asked Questions (FAQs)
Q1. What are the must-try Indian dishes for beginners?
If you’re new to Indian cuisine, start simple. Butter chicken, samosas, biryani, and dal tadka are easy on the palate while offering authentic flavors.
Q2. Where can I find authentic Indian food in Canada?
Cities like Toronto, Vancouver, Montreal, and Calgary are hubs for authentic Indian dining. Additionally, you can shop for Indian ingredients at major grocery stores or specialty shops.
Q3. How does Indian food cater to vegetarians?
Indian cuisine is highly vegetarian-friendly. Dishes like palak paneer, aloo gobi, and masoor dal make Indian food a paradise for herbivores. Most restaurants also offer extensive vegetarian options.
Q4. Is Indian food always spicy?
Not necessarily! Indian dishes can range from mild and creamy (like butter chicken) to fiery and bold (like vindaloo). Most restaurants happily adjust the spice levels to your preference.
Q5. Can Indian food be healthy?
Absolutely! Indian cuisine uses fresh, wholesome ingredients like lentils, vegetables, and whole grains. Many recipes are rich in nutrients and prepared with heart-healthy spices.
Bringing Indian Cuisine into Your Life
Indian food in Canada is more than just delicious meals — it’s a cultural bridge connecting two nations. Whether you’re visiting an authentic restaurant, testing recipes at home, or shopping for fresh spices and ingredients, it’s never been easier to immerse yourself in the rich flavors of Indian cuisine.
Are you ready to explore this world of spices, textures, and aromas? Why not start with that thali or curry you’ve been daydreaming about! Your next food adventure awaits.
1 Comment
Pingback: How to Save Money While Eating Healthy in Canada